We make mistakes, but we make them quicker, with OpenRoads. No need to be afraid of committing a cardinal sin in OpenRoads, undo will save you back to safety. The Undo/Redo is one of the best working functions in OpenRoads! Anyone coming from the GeoPAK background involved in overwriting critical ".gpk" data (is the redefine button on?) can experience commitment issues to changes and iterations, hence the ever-growing library of "working" or "dated" files found in their file system. It takes time to build up the libraries of data to support OpenRoads technology properly (templates, civil cells, etc.). If your state DOT is coming from a GeoPAK background, be prepared to modify tools and create new preferences. The key to making OpenRoads run like you expect is to set up the workspace properly and tuning it to your needs. Given Six Hours to Chop a Tree, Spend the First Four Sharpening the Axe Spend the time to understand the limitations of OpenRoads technology to best fit your needs.
